view ♦ ♦ | Report Content as Inappropriate ♦ ♦ Error -9939 with plugin called in 4D compiled mode 4D SDK : 2004.5 MacOSX : 10.4.8 PPC Xcode : 2.4.1 PPC Hello I have migrated my 4D plugin from 4D 2004.0 SDK to 4D 2004.5 SDK and added two additional functions with the 4D plugin wizard. The plugin compiles without any error under Xcode 2.4.1 and runs perfect (all function calls and returns) in a test 4D structure in interpreted mode under 4D 2004.5. The test 4D structure compiles also without any error and warnings (explicit typing). When running the same test 4D structure in compiled mode, every call to the functions of the plugin evokes the error -9939 (external routine is not found) and the plugin call fails. In the new added function I made use of cocoa/objective-c classes and methods of the foundation framework - the plugin is compiled with the objective-c compiler - has this any influence to the plugin calls under 4D compiled mode? I would appreciate any hint how to resolve the problem. Can you help?I compiled a program for a client under 6.0.5, and he gets the message as described.Resolution:When http://4d.1045681.n5.nabble.com/Error-9939-with-plugin-called-in-4D-compiled-mode-td1412918.html you are executing code from within 4D, and get the -9939 error, this usually means that something went wrong with the installation of the plug-in. Like I stated in my previous email, there is no straight forward answer http://kb.4d.com/search/assetid=3092 of why this could be happening. Possible things to look and check for are:1. Make sure the plug-in is in its correct folder. Since you are going cross-platform, make sure you have the Mac and PC versions of the plug-in.2. Make sure that the plug-ins are named correctly. 3. Make sure that all the plug-ins that are needed are installed. If you are missing a plug-in that is being called, this error message will appear, because it is being called, but can not find the plug-in.It was also stated: "The resource cache file cannot be created."Take a look at this tech tip, it could possibly help your situation: http://www.acius.com/tech%5Ftips/tips99%2D192.html

The levels include 4d error "Administrator", "Staff1", or "Staff2" Have you have typed in the password exactly as it is spelled. I Am Getting An "Error 9939" Message When I Open My Program. What Do I Do? The "9939" error message means that your Win4dx (Windows) or Mac4DX (Macintosh) directory/folder isn't in the same directory/folder as the executable application. To fix this you must Quit the program and put that directory/folder back into the Private Advantage directory/folder. I'm Getting 4d error 9939 a "There has been an interruption while writing to disk" or a "Run 4D Tools" Message When I Open My Program. What Do I Do? The most common causes of this error are: an electrical surge while your computer was on quitting the program improperly (Don't shut the program off by clicking on the X in the upper right corner) a power outage when the computer is on The computer freezing or crashing. To check for damage and/or repair the data file you must run 4D Tools. 4D Tools is located in your Utilities directory. See the directions below for running 4D Tools. How Do I Compact My Data File?
